What is Grok Bot?
Grok Bot is separate from the ordinary Grok chatbot available on grok.com, X and the Grok mobile app.
Regular Grok primarily answers, researches, reasons and creates inside a conversation. Grok Bot is designed to take a task into a working environment and complete the surrounding actions. A Bot can open websites, sign into apps, work with files, use a terminal, call connected tools and continue after the user's device is closed.
SpaceXAI describes each Bot as a persistent, named teammate. A user might create a researcher, an account manager, an operations assistant and a chief of staff, then place them in a group conversation so they can pass work among themselves.
The approachable interface is the main product idea. Instead of building a conventional automation flow before anything useful happens, the user describes a job in a message, supplies the relevant access and reviews the result.
That simplicity does not remove the underlying complexity. Grok Bot is still operating a remote computer, authenticating with outside services, choosing actions and consuming metered AI usage. The friendly names make the system easier to direct. They do not make permissions, cost or failure handling disappear.

How Grok Bot works
Each user receives a persistent managed cloud computer with a browser, filesystem and terminal. Connectors and MCP-enabled tools can provide structured access where available, while computer use lets a Bot work through websites and applications without a dedicated integration.
Named Bots retain their role, conversation and preferences. They can also exchange messages, join group conversations and hand off tasks. Several Bots can reason and work in parallel, with each Bot receiving its own screen on the shared computer.
The word "shared" matters.
All Bots belonging to one user operate on the same cloud computer. They can access its shared files, browser sessions, signed-in accounts and command-line credentials. One Bot can continue from work another has saved, which makes collaboration practical. It also means separate Bots cannot be treated as separate security zones. The official architecture documentation states this boundary directly.
Several launch-week reports described each Bot as receiving an isolated computer. The current official documentation is more precise: each user receives one account-level computer, each Bot receives its own screen, and all of that user's Bots share the underlying files, sessions and credentials. This analysis follows the official architecture rather than the conflicting summaries.
The official documentation recommends keeping passwords, two-factor codes, passkeys, CAPTCHAs and payment confirmations out of ordinary chat. For those steps, the user takes control of the cloud computer, completes the sensitive action and hands control back.
What can Grok Bot do?
The current product is broad enough to cover research, operations, sales, marketing, support, recruiting, product work and engineering. The useful distinction is that it can act across several tools rather than producing a draft that stops inside chat.
Work across websites and apps
A Bot can navigate browser-based services, use connected tools, work with files and run terminal commands. This allows it to update a CRM, collect information from several sources, prepare a document, reproduce a software issue or leave completed work in the application where a person expects to find it.
Sites can still block automation, request a fresh login, show a CAPTCHA or require human confirmation. A connector is generally more reliable than visual browser control when both are available.
Run several Bots in parallel
Users can assign different roles to different Bots and allow them to coordinate through direct messages, threads or group conversations. A research Bot can collect material, a writing Bot can turn it into a draft, and a supervising Bot can review the output or request another pass.
This reduces the amount of copying and re-explaining between separate AI chats. It does not guarantee that the Bots will choose the right division of work or catch one another's errors.
Remember roles and working preferences
Named Bots can retain stable preferences, role context and summaries of earlier work. Files, shared browser sessions and explicit handoffs can move additional context between Bots.
Memory is useful for continuity, although it should not become the source of truth for current prices, policies or business decisions. SpaceXAI's own documentation advises asking a Bot to check the current source when accuracy matters.
Turn a successful task into a reusable skill
A skill records how to perform a job, including the inputs, sequence, decision rules, expected output, validation steps and approval boundaries.
Grok Bot can also create a draft skill from a demonstrated browser workflow when the "Teach a task" feature is available. The user performs the process once for up to ten minutes, reviews the generated instructions and tests them on a safe example.
A demonstration captures visible steps. It may miss the judgment, exceptions and failure handling that an experienced person applies without thinking. The generated skill should be treated as a first draft.
Run recurring routines
A routine assigns a workflow to one Bot and tells it when to run. Routines can operate on a schedule while the user's laptop is closed. Supported integrations may also trigger work from events such as a Slack message or GitHub notification.
Grok Bot currently allows a Bot to own up to 50 routines and keeps the 20 most recent run records for each routine. SpaceXAI recommends testing a routine before enabling it and defining what should happen when source data is missing or stale.
Start and supervise work from an iPhone
The iOS app connects to the same Bots, conversations, routines, connectors and cloud computer as the desktop application. Users can start tasks, attach files or photos, answer questions, review results, approve steps and take over the computer for sensitive actions.
Some advanced controls remain desktop-only. Editing a routine, inspecting full run history and teaching a workflow currently require the desktop app.
What Grok Bot cannot safely promise
The launch language presents Bots as teammates that finish work and return only when approval is required. That is the product ambition, not an independently established reliability rate.
Choosely has not completed documented hands-on testing, and SpaceXAI has not published a simple success rate for end-to-end jobs across third-party applications. Early users may find impressive completions alongside login friction, blocked websites, incorrect decisions, incomplete work and expensive retries.
Current practical limits include:
- A website may block automation or require human takeover.
- One Bot can run one computer-use task on its screen at a time.
- Teach-by-demonstration is rolling out gradually.
- Push notifications are still rolling out.
- Android, iPad and Linux desktop are unsupported at launch.
- The product depends on cloud storage and persistent account access.
- Included weekly usage is described by tier rather than published as a universal number of tasks.
- A long agent run can consume a large share of trial or paid usage.
The correct benchmark is completed useful work after corrections, retries and review time. A charming group chat is not a productivity result.
Several third-party launch reports list a Linux build. The current official setup guide explicitly says Grok Bot is unavailable as a Linux desktop app, so Choosely follows macOS, Windows and iPhone as the supported surfaces until SpaceXAI changes that documentation.
How much does Grok Bot cost?
Grok Bot does not currently have one standalone subscription price. Access is included through eligible Cursor plans or granted by linking an eligible individual SuperGrok account to a Cursor account. The official billing guide explains how the eligible routes share weekly and on-demand usage.
| Access route | Advertised starting price | Grok Bot position |
|---|---|---|
| Grok Bot trial | Free usage credit with a seven-day window | Credit is consumed by agent steps and tokens, so duration varies |
| Cursor Pro+ | US$60 per month | Included with generous weekly usage below Ultra |
| Cursor Ultra | US$200 per month | Highest weekly Cursor usage |
| Cursor Teams Standard | US$40 per user per month | Included for every member on a self-serve team |
| Cursor Teams Premium | US$120 per user per month | Included with five times the Standard team allowance |
| SuperGrok Plus | US$100 per month | Grants generous linked usage below Heavy |
| SuperGrok Heavy | US$300 per month | Grants the highest linked usage |
| Cursor Enterprise | Custom | Access and controls depend on managed rollout |
All listed prices are monthly US prices before applicable taxes. Cursor's current pricing documentation confirms Pro+ at US$60, Ultra at US$200, Teams Standard at US$40 per user and Teams Premium at US$120 per user. SpaceXAI's current selector lists SuperGrok Plus at US$100 and Heavy at US$300. Recheck every amount immediately before publication.
Regular Cursor Pro and basic SuperGrok do not include Grok Bot. SuperGrok Team and Enterprise subscriptions also cannot currently be linked through the individual SuperGrok route.
The cheapest route is not automatically the best-value route
For an individual who wants Grok Bot and already values Cursor's coding tools, Pro+ is the clearest entry point at US$60 per month. SuperGrok Plus costs US$100 per month but also includes higher usage across Grok Chat, Imagine, Voice and Build, along with 1080p video creation and priority access.
Teams can enter at a lower per-person sticker price through Cursor Teams Standard, although the total bill scales with seats and usage.
The correct comparison is the whole subscription being purchased, not Grok Bot in isolation.
Usage can extend beyond the subscription
Paid Grok Bot access includes usage that resets weekly. When the included allowance is exhausted, eligible Cursor accounts can continue through shared on-demand spending if it is enabled.
The trial is also usage-based. It comes with a seven-day window, but a large or long-running job can consume most or all of the trial credit in one run. Used trial credit is not restored simply because the result was disappointing.
One more detail deserves attention: linking an individual SuperGrok subscription to a Cursor account is described as permanent. The link cannot currently be removed or moved to another Cursor account without support intervention. Check the signed-in account carefully before confirming it.
Grok Bot security and privacy
Grok Bot's strongest feature and its largest risk come from the same place. It can enter the systems where real work happens.
Every Bot can reach the shared environment
Files, browser sessions and command-line credentials placed on the user-level cloud computer are available across that user's Bot roster. A sales Bot and a finance Bot may have different names and instructions, but those names do not create technical isolation.
Use separate service accounts, narrow permissions and temporary access where the connected platform supports them. Sign out of services and remove sensitive files when a project ends.
Approval rules need to be explicit
SpaceXAI recommends approval boundaries for sending messages, publishing, purchasing, transferring money, deleting data, changing permissions, modifying production systems and accepting legal terms.
Grok Bot offers "Require Approval" and "Always Allow" rules when Auto Review enforcement is available. Auto Review is model-based and should complement least privilege. It should not become permission to allow everything in a browser. SpaceXAI's security and privacy guide recommends narrow rules for consequential actions.
An approval also controls the proposed action only. It does not reverse earlier work the Bot has already completed.
Cloud storage is required
Grok Bot uses Cursor authentication and account data settings. It requires cloud data storage and does not support Cursor's Legacy Privacy Mode. Training opt-out follows the applicable Cursor account and privacy settings.
Organizations should review current Cursor security documentation, contractual terms, retention controls and administrative settings before connecting customer information, production infrastructure or regulated data.
Who should consider Grok Bot?
Grok Bot is most relevant to people whose work contains repeatable multi-step jobs spread across several tools.
Good candidates include:
- Solo operators who repeatedly research, prepare and publish structured work.
- Sales teams that research accounts and prepare outreach for human approval.
- Operations teams that reconcile information across inboxes, portals and internal systems.
- Product and engineering teams that reproduce issues, prepare tickets and hand work between specialists.
- Agencies that can define clear client boundaries and reusable processes.
- Existing Cursor Pro+ or Ultra users who already pay for an eligible plan.
The best first task has a clear finish line, uses replaceable or low-risk data and leaves consequential action for human approval.
Examples include preparing a weekly competitor brief, reconciling a non-sensitive report, drafting support responses, organizing research into a document or reproducing a bug in staging.
Who should wait?
Grok Bot is a weaker fit for:
- Anyone seeking a cheap general chatbot.
- Teams that cannot place work or credentials on a persistent cloud computer.
- Regulated organizations that have not completed security and procurement review.
- Users expecting fixed, easily understood task limits.
- Workflows where a mistaken send, purchase, deletion or production change would be difficult to reverse.
- People who need Android, iPad or Linux desktop support today.
- Teams without enough repeated work to justify setup, supervision and a subscription.
For a one-off question, document or research task, a conventional assistant may remain faster and cheaper.
Grok Bot versus ChatGPT Work and Claude Cowork
Grok Bot enters a market already moving beyond chat.
Its clearest specialist identity is persistent delegated work. Multiple named Bots share a cloud computer, continue while the user's devices are closed, message one another and turn successful work into scheduled routines.
ChatGPT Work is currently the broader connected workspace in Choosely's assessment, especially when work crosses research, cloud services, reusable artifacts and multiple devices. Claude Cowork has the sharper file-heavy and desktop-centered identity, particularly when the job begins in source folders and ends in a polished professional deliverable.
Grok Bot becomes the interesting choice when the user wants several persistent roles operating inside live tools with minimal workflow-building overhead. It also asks for a larger leap of trust because its value increases as more applications, files and credentials enter the shared environment.

Frequently asked questions
Is Grok Bot the same as Grok on X?
No. Grok on X and grok.com is the general AI assistant. Grok Bot is a separate agent product that operates through a persistent cloud computer and uses a Cursor account for authentication.
Can Grok Bot work while my computer is off?
Yes. Work runs on the cloud computer, so closing the desktop app, laptop or iPhone does not stop an active background turn or routine.
Does every Grok Bot have its own computer?
Not exactly. Every user receives one persistent cloud computer. All Bots belonging to that user share its files, browser sessions, app logins and command-line credentials, although each Bot receives its own screen for parallel work.
Is Grok Bot free?
There is a free usage-credit trial with a seven-day window. Continued access requires Cursor Pro+, Cursor Ultra, a self-serve Cursor Teams plan, or a linked individual SuperGrok Plus or Heavy subscription. The ordinary free Grok plan does not include Grok Bot.
What is the cheapest Grok Bot plan?
The lowest advertised team route is Cursor Teams Standard at US$40 per user per month. For an individual account, Cursor Pro+ is the clearest advertised entry route at US$60 per month. Prices exclude applicable taxes and should be checked live.
Is Grok Bot available on Android or iPad?
No. At launch, Grok Bot supports macOS, Windows and iPhone with iOS 18 or later. Android, iPad and Linux desktop are not supported.
Can Grok Bot send emails or make purchases?
It can operate in tools where those actions are possible, subject to access and controls. Users should require approval before sending, publishing, purchasing, deleting, transferring funds or changing production systems.
